## Sharding the Profile Store (Murkwater service)

Future maintainers: user profiles in Murkwater are sharded by a stable hash of the account ID across sixteen logical shards, mapped to four physical clusters. Never rebalance without freezing writes first — the mapper caches shard routes for ten minutes. Resharding tooling lives in the shardwright repo. Access to the mapper's admin console requires the recovery passphrase given below.

unlock words, hahip-baduf: holwyn-istath-julvan

Onboarding note for the Ledgerpane admin table: bulk edits are applied through the batcher service, not directly against the database. Select rows, choose an action, and the batcher stages changes in a pending set you can review before commit. Edits over 500 rows require a second approver — this is enforced server-side, so don't try to chunk around it. To run the batcher locally you need the staging write credential, which goes in your .env as the next line.

secret setting of bahip-kagag: RELAY_SECRET3=c83

Step 2: Migrate tile cache metadata

Stop the Quarry render workers. Run the schema upgrade to add the zoom-level partitioning column. Rebuild the eviction index before restarting; skipping it causes full-cache scans. Old metadata rows are dropped automatically after verification. Confirm the upgrade completed by connecting to the cache metadata database with the string below.

replica DSN, yahog-kawig: redis://istox_svc:um@db-8a67.halixforge.test:5432/frawyn

Break-Glass Access — Northgale Health Check Plane. Our services sit behind the Cormorant load balancer, which probes each node every five seconds on the internal health port. During an incident, a responder may need to force a node healthy to restore capacity while a fix lands. This is break-glass only: it bypasses the probe logic and must be reverted within one hour. The override console refuses normal credentials by design. To open it, the responder enters the break-glass recovery passphrase shown below.

recovery phrase for fajep-yaweg: gilath-sorox-wenius-rusdor-keliel-zorius